What would be a good price to pay to an electrician for installing 2
outdoor motion activated flood lights, one on the back of the house
and one on the side with the garage? the wiring would have to be run
to that location, and a switch as well to control it.[would the
switch be necessary?]

No way to know. It could be a couple hours if there are appropriate
circuits available where you want the lights; it could be a couple days if
he has to run new circuits and there is no good way to route them.

I put one in two years ago. The instructions said a switch was required,
but it would have been a lot of work and I didn't want one anyhow, so I left
it out. It works fine; don't know why they say one is required. YMMV
